4G94 SOHC 16v Engine Conversions

Many people wish to do engine swaps to replace this engine for various reasons. To produce horsepower readings in excess of 150hp takes quite a large amount of money and eventually reaches a point where you cannot really go any further with the engine. Below are RPW suggested best value engine swaps. The ratio of value to cost increases as you move down the list. The final engine descriptions can be done but are not a worth while conversion to do in our opinion. There are various reasons for this but consider this.

Any time you increase the horsepower of the vehicle, you need to look at brakes, suspension, engine management systems, chassis strengthening, traction, tyre sizes. To go to the extreme - stick a 500hp engine in your Lancer / Mirage 1.5 model vehicle. There is no hope of traction, any remote ability to even handle consistently when you accelerate. Chassis twist is a real problem as is torque steer which cannot really be overcome. Sure you can go to a 4wd conversion but at this stage unless you have sources of income on the illegitimate side, or love throwing your money away, why are you using this vehicle. The point being at some point you need to realise that there are better vehicles to work with and this may not be the one.

On the other hand, we have found that the recommended model engines, work extremely well, provide a nicely balanced vehicle that is definitely faster and has better acceleration and can work within the reasonable bounds of the standard chassis and available suspension packages. All we say is THINK about what you are doing and be certain you have enough money to finish what you started.

RPW suggested Engine Swaps ranked from best to worst.

6A13 SOHC 24 valve engine - rated 120kw factory (larger capacity means torque, bolts right into the car, readily & cheaply available)

6A12 DOHC 24 valve engine - rated 120kw factory (smaller capacity but better breathing)

6A12 DOHC 24 valve Mivec - rated 150kw factory (Our highest recommendation but getting up there in value)

4G93 DOHC 16 valve engine - rated 100kw factory (Hard to find but worthwhile to fit.)

4G93 DOHC 16 valve turbo - rated 160kw factory (Even harder to find)

4G63 DOHC 16 valve turbo - rated 206kw factory (Can be fitted, requires major modifications to balance of vehicle)

4G94 DOHC 16 valve Mivec - New product being developed by RPW.
